How much do weekend apprentice jobs pay per hour?

As of May 30, 2026, the average hourly pay for weekend apprentice in Silver Spring, MD is $20.85,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$17.64 and $22.60 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are Weekend Apprentices?

Weekend Apprentices are individuals who participate in apprenticeship programs that take place primarily on weekends. These roles are designed for people who may have weekday commitments, such as school or another job, but want to gain hands-on experience and training in a specific trade or profession. Weekend Apprenticeships can be found in various industries, such as hospitality, retail, construction, and automotive services. They provide practical skills, mentorship, and often lead to full-time opportunities or certifications. This flexible format allows participants to develop valuable job skills without interfering with their weekday responsibilities.

What is the highest paid apprenticeship job?

The highest paid apprenticeship jobs often include roles such as electrical, plumbing, or HVAC apprentices, with some specialized trades earning annual wages exceeding $60,000 after gaining experience. Skilled trades that require technical knowledge and certifications tend to offer higher pay compared to other apprenticeships, especially in industries with high demand for skilled workers.
